'I've made Arsenal's season' - Watford captain Troy Deeney claims he has turned Gunners' season around

Troy Deeney believes he has 'made Arsenal's season' and defended his outspoken comments about the Gunners in the past.

Back in October, the Watford skipper suggested Arsene Wenger's side lacked 'cojones' after the Hornets beat them 2-1 at Vicarage Road.

Deeney came off the bench and bullied the backline, scoring the winner from the spot before saying: "Having a bit of cojones, I think the word is. Whenever I play against Arsenal – and this is just a personal thing – I go up and think 'Let me whack the first one, then we will see who wants it’.
